Nagaland: Agricultural Technology Management Agency Peren holds board meeting

Agricultural Technology Management Agency (ATMA) Peren held a governing board meeting on Friday, in the conference hall of the deputy commissioner (DC) Peren.
In a press release, ATMA Peren deputy project director, Kumui Nring informed that district soil conservation department, land resource department, Krishi Vigyan Kendra, water resource department, district horticulture department, district sericulture department and fisheries & aquatic resources department presented ongoing departmental projects and schemes implemented in the district during the meeting.
ATMA Peren also presented on organisational set-up and activities carried out at various block levels.


In his speech, DC Peren, Vineet Kumar, who is also the chairman of ATMA governing board emphasised on the need to conduct governing board meetings not only on quarterly basis but as often as possible, in order to create better coordination among agri and allied departments.
He asked responsible departments to be positive in their approach towards upliftment of farmers in Peren district.
In this regard, he requested the departments to submit papers or present existing plans, schemes and projects.
To subjugate better workability, we must contribute jointly, the DC stated. He also remarked that the agri and allied departments were interrelated and that joint effort and better coordination will bear visible implantation.
